Ingredients
For the Casserole Base
- 1 lb lean ground turkey
- 2 medium sweet potatoes (about 2 cups, cubed)
- 1 medium onion (diced)
- 2 cloves garlic (minced)
- 1 bell pepper (diced)
- 2 cups fresh spinach or kale
For the Cheese Topping
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
For Seasoning
- 2 tsp olive oil
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 tsp paprika
- 1 tsp dried thyme
How to Make Ground Turkey Sweet Potato Casserole
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). This ensures that your casserole bakes evenly from the start.
Step 2: Cook the Ground Turkey
In a large skillet over medium heat:
* Add 2 tsp of olive oil.
* Add the 1 lb lean ground turkey, seasoning it with salt, pepper, paprika, and thyme.
* Cook until browned, which should take about 5–7 minutes.
Step 3: Sauté the Vegetables
Once the turkey is cooked:
* Add the diced 1 medium onion and diced 1 bell pepper to the skillet.
* Cook until softened, approximately 5 minutes.
Step 4: Add Greens
Stir in:
* The 2 cups fresh spinach or kale, allowing it to wilt for a couple of minutes.
Step 5: Combine with Sweet Potatoes
In a mixing bowl:
* Combine the cooked turkey-veggie mixture with cubed sweet potatoes (about 2 cups) and toss well.
Step 6: Bake the Casserole
Transfer everything into a greased baking dish:
* Top with shredded cheddar (1 cup) and mozzarella cheese (1 cup).
* Bake for 25–30 minutes until bubbly and golden on top.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
To ensure your Ground Turkey Sweet Potato Casserole turns out perfectly, be aware of these common mistakes.
- Skipping Pre-cooking the Turkey: Ensure you properly cook the ground turkey before adding other ingredients. This enhances flavor and texture.
- Overcooking the Sweet Potatoes: If you boil or steam sweet potatoes beforehand, keep them slightly firm. They will finish cooking in the oven without becoming mushy.
- Neglecting Seasoning: Don’t forget to season each layer of your casserole. Adding salt and spices during cooking elevates the overall taste.
- Using Low-Quality Cheese: Opt for good-quality cheddar and mozzarella. Cheaper cheeses may not melt well, affecting the dish’s texture and flavor.
- Not Allowing to Rest After Baking: Let the casserole sit for a few minutes after baking. This helps it set, making it easier to serve.
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store leftovers in an airtight container.
- Enjoy within 3-4 days for optimal freshness.
Freezing Ground Turkey Sweet Potato Casserole
- Use a freezer-safe container or wrap tightly in aluminum foil.
- Freeze for up to 2-3 months for best quality.
Reheating Ground Turkey Sweet Potato Casserole
-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and bake for about 20-25 minutes, covered with foil until heated through.
- Microwave: Heat in a microwave-safe dish for 2-3 minutes on high, stirring halfway through for even warming.
- Stovetop: Place in a skillet over medium heat with a splash of broth; stir occasionally until heated through.
